Vickers and Nolan Enterprises (VNE) is an engineering company that provides Government projects and programs with experienced and dedicated system architects, engineers, subject matter experts (in tactical intelligence), and program managers. VNE also develops training courses and tools to prepare warfighters to effectively employ tactical intelligence systems and provide management guidance to the Government organizations that develop these systems.
VNE has earned a reputation for exceptional performance, innovation, agility, and responsiveness in the Intelligence Community (IC). We attack our mission with a comprehensive understanding of the data available and required; skilled research, design, development, integration, and testing of systems and software solutions; expertise in cybersecurity/information assurance and technology; programmatic, acquisition, and logistics support know-how; and our own unique training curricula that enables students to excel at intelligence operations across all levels of the community.
VNE is devoted to improving tactical operations at home and abroad by enabling the seamless transition of data across the intelligence community and developing/integrating solutions to unify operations and intelligence.
VNE is a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) founded in 2004 in Stafford, VA.
VNE, LLC is looking for a Program / Project Manager III
Minimum Qualifications:
Education: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Physical Sciences, Mathematics, Management Information Systems, or Business.
Experience: Fifteen (15) years of technical experience in support of program/projects, to include: Equipment Support, System Support, and Programmatic Support. Experience shall include at least eight (8) years of Program Management experience, to include: Technology Assessments, Systems Design, Systems Analysis, Programmatic Support, Acquisition Planning, and Budget Planning. Knowledge of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) and DoD procurement policies and procedures. Individual shall have written and oral communications abilities commensurate with this management role.
Desired Experience:
- Experience with NIWC Atlantic organizations, processes, and procedures
- Experience with Lean Portfolio Management
- Experience using Agile tools such as Jira and ServiceNow
Job Description:
- Defines, communicates, and delivers on project milestones, deliverables, and service levels for a large Enterprise IT effort
- Assesses, measures, and monitors contract activities
- Manages and updates spend plans, invoices, and deliverables for compliance with established requirements
- Assists with estimation, preparation, and justification in planning, programming, and budgeting activities
- Allocates resources (staffing, facilities, and budgets) on the contract
- Identifies, reviews, and communicates risks and opportunities
- Prepares program status reports and other formal reviews
- Maintains dashboards and reports to communicate project, contract, and financial performance and performance trends
- Prepares and implements corrective action plans
